#!/usr/bin/python
# @lint-avoid-python-3-compatibility-imports
#
# vfsstat Count some VFS calls.
# For Linux, uses BCC, eBPF. See .c file.
#
# Written as a basic example of counting multiple events as a stat tool.
#
# USAGE: vfsstat [interval [count]]
#
# Copyright (c) 2015 Brendan Gregg.
# Licensed under the Apache License, Version 2.0 (the "License")
#
# 14-Aug-2015 Brendan Gregg Created this.
from __future__ import print_function
from bcc import BPF
from ctypes import c_int
from time import sleep, strftime
from sys import argv
def usage():
print("USAGE: %s [interval [count]]" % argv[0])
exit()
# arguments
interval = 1
count = -1
if len(argv) > 1:
try:
interval = int(argv[1])
if interval == 0:
raise
if len(argv) > 2:
count = int(argv[2])
except: # also catches -h, --help
usage()
